一. 应用需求在vue开发项目的过程中,需要在自己的页面框架中,引用别人做的页面功能,但又不想直接跳转,失去整个系统的统一性,只想在这个子页面(子路由里跳转),那么如何实现呢?很简单!iframe就可以帮我们完成! 本文将以嵌入哔哩哔哩为例,实际开发中,你需要嵌入什么就嵌入什么,只需要在路由中更改名字和链接的url即可。二、实现过程1、侧边栏的实现以下代码都是在sideMenu.vue侧边栏组件中
VUE组件嵌套vue中组件嵌套烦分为两种,分别是全局注册组件和局部注册组件基本步骤:1、在components 下创建一个新的.vue结尾的文件,文件首字母最好是大写,基于规范复制代码2、分别写出结构层<template></template>、行为层<script></script>和样式层<style></style>复制
转载
2020-06-17 22:04:22
1897阅读
vue项目关于iframe嵌套的相关问题总结(一)因为最近做的项目涉及到项目跨项目共用页面,也就是iframe嵌套,之前对着一块也不是很了解,所以想把遇到的问题及解决办法总结一下。可能会有不严谨或者理解不周到的地方,希望读到文章的大佬能够发指出。 首先,说一下项目的需求吧,A系统要调用B系统的某个页面,并且要实现相关指定功能,具体步骤及需求如下:在 A系统创建对应嵌套页面的路由:{
前奏最近在做考试系统,需要实现: 标题栏点击对应的菜单,底部主区域动态加载对应的界面 红色区域就是要动态替换的 界面通过访问 uri 进行加载 想要结果的,可以直接滑到最后~挫折之路首先想到的就是 iframe,但是它有很大的缺点:不能高度自适应!!!虽然滚动条及边框可以去掉,但是去掉滚动条之后,就不能滚动了,即使内容还没有展示完!!!如果写死 iframe 的高度,或者只在一开始获取 ifram
一、组件之间的嵌套(普通)1、效果图2、MyFather.vue<template> <div> <MySon></MySon> </div></template><script>i
原创
2022-05-24 18:10:55
288阅读
主要是用来嵌套网页的。所以你要引入另一个页面就用<iframe> 嵌套页面: <iframe src="head.html" width="100%" height=196px></iframe> 样式:iframe{ border: none; overflow:hidden; margin-bo ...
转载
2021-10-29 10:41:00
942阅读
2评论
其实就是在容器组件里放一个插槽(slot)。VUE的看点是组件。组件应用的典型例子,是
原创
2022-08-15 10:56:37
370阅读
其实不难,确切说很简单,先看一下官网中的name作用name 类型:string 息。另外,当在有 vue-devtoo...
原创
2023-02-27 15:49:08
117阅读
一、Iframe标记的使用Iframe标记,又叫浮动帧标记,你可以用它将一个HTML文档嵌入在一个HTML中显示。它不同于Frame标记最大的特征即这个标记所引用的HTML文件不是与另外的HTML文件相互独立显示,而是可以直接嵌入在一个HTML文件中,与这个HTML文件内容相互融合,成为一个整体,另外,还可以多次在一个页面内显示同一内容,而不必重复写内容,一个形象的比喻即“画中画“电视。现在我们谈
下午经理让我在客户服务平台创建一个新的路由,把我们之前写的报表工具嵌套进去,之前的是通过ip访问的,讨论了一会决定用神器 iframe,直接嵌套进去,之前也写过,代码这个东西,CV才是精髓,去某度看了一下,随后开始操作 首先创建好了路由的权限,让他在页面也可以进行点点点的操作,之后创建vue页面去页面看看成功出现,下面看一下我之前开发的页面的样子,记住这个ip,这个页面非常完美啊,有条件查询,有分
简单说一下场景。 假设有A、B、C和D四个JSP页面,D通过iframe嵌套在C中,C通过iframe嵌套在B中,B通过iframe嵌套在A中。 然后现在在D中编写JavaScript代码跳转页面。 在本页面跳转(D页面所在的iframe中跳转) 在上一层跳转(D页面所在iframe的父页面中跳转,
转载
2019-08-18 09:57:00
1977阅读
2评论
我们在日常浏览网页时经常看到各式各样的网页,会发现一般的网页,它会拥有一个导航栏, 在导航栏中我们可以进行多方面的选择或进行搜索,可以实现多页面的跳转, 但是在进行页面跳转之后,导航栏还是存在,或者隐藏到一边, 因为它们有一个主页面或属于同一个软件的网页,是不是这样呢,相信你很清楚。 在程序员的眼中,实现这样跳转的方法有很多种。 如果两个网页互不存在关系,但是他们发布的平台相同的,可以存在跳转,
使用的是vue-element-admin。需求项目需求是在点击左边侧边栏的时候判断如果是外部的页面之后,将此页面在右侧打开,每打开一个,tagview中也会相应加上,当切换这些tagview时,要保持每个页面切换前的状态,就是不重载。尝试 新建了iframe.vue文件,里面套iframe标签,通过地址的参数不同,跳转不同的iframe页面,但是在做切换时,会导致iframe页面重载,利用了ke
如果你哪个页面不想被嵌套 下面js代码可以解决(我的是火狐) 慎用
转载
2023-06-06 09:30:48
253阅读
前面显示Home.vue页面组件的内容时,我们是在App.vue通过import导入使用的。这个过程就是组件的嵌套使用。那么我们除了App.vue可以导入其他页面以外,也可以通过在Home.vue中导入其他子组件进行使用的。 src/ |- views/ |- Home.vue |- compone ...
转载
2021-10-01 21:30:00
192阅读
2评论
最近在用 uniapp 写一个小程序,使用到了uniapp的 collapse 组件 去实现一个 树形下拉列表,考虑到树形结构,就自己封装了下组件用于递归。 具体实现 template <view class="" v-for="(item, index) in list" :key="index" ...
转载
2021-08-15 08:58:00
606阅读
2评论
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document<
原创
2022-07-31 00:06:41
71阅读
Vue给iframe设置嵌套页面的宽高,代码示例如下: <template> <iframe id="iframe" :height="scrollHeight" :width="scrollWidth" frameborder=0 allowfullscreen="true" src="/docs
更改iframe中src值后导致的路由跳转混乱,多次更改iframe的src属性后,调用router.go(-1),不能实现路由后退上一级。:还是在于通过ifream.src赋值,因为域相同,还是会向window.history中插入一条历史记录。
原创
2023-09-26 15:01:24
589阅读